The Evolution and Anatomy of the Sash Window

To understand the requirement of a professional, one should first understand the intricate style of the sash window. Coming from the late 17th century, the standard "box sash" includes one or more movable panels (sashes) that slide vertically. This movement is helped with by lead or iron weights hidden within a hollow "box" frame, linked to the sashes by long lasting cords running over pulley-blocks.

Specialists in this field recognize that each era brought distinct styles:

  • Georgian: Often featured the "six-over-six" pane setup with thick glazing bars.
  • Victorian: Favored bigger panes of glass, typically "two-over-two," as glass-making technology enhanced.
  • Edwardian: Frequently made use of a "multi-pane over single-pane" design to maximize light.

Typical Challenges Faced by Sash Window Owners

Over years, or perhaps centuries, lumber windows go through the elements, causing unavoidable wear and tear. Sash window specialists identify several repeating concerns that require professional intervention:

  • Timber Rot: Moisture ingress, especially in the bottom rail and sills, can result in fungal decay.
  • Sash Cord Failure: Cords can fray or snap with time, rendering the window harmful or unusable.
  • Taken Pulleys: Repeated painting can obstruct pulley wheels, avoiding the smooth movement of the weights.
  • Thermal Inefficiency: Original single glazing and spaces around the sashes result in considerable heat loss and rattling.
  • Distorted Frames: Structural shifting of the building can trigger frames to warp, making windows difficult to open or close.

The Role of the Sash Window Expert

An expert does not simply "fix" a window; they engage in a meticulous repair procedure. This involves a deep understanding of wood science, joinery, and glazing. Professionals typically utilize innovative materials like Accoya ® timber, a chemically modified wood that is practically rot-proof and offers incredible dimensional stability.

The Restoration Process

The methodical technique taken by specialists usually follows these phases:

  1. Assessment: An extensive survey to identify rot, structural damage, and hardware performance.
  2. Taking apart: Careful elimination of staff beads, parting beads, and the sashes themselves.
  3. Paint Removal and Repair: Stripping layers of old lead-based paint and utilizing epoxy resins or "splice" repair work for damaged wood.
  4. Balancing: Re-weighing the sashes and adjusting the internal weights to ensure the window "floats" effortlessly.
  5. Draught-Proofing: Installing discreet brush strips into the beads and conference rails to eliminate rattles and cold air.
  6. Re-glazing: Often involving the setup of slim-profile double glazing designed to suit initial sash rebates.

Table 2: Materials Used by Sash Window Specialists

MaterialApplicationAdvantage
Accoya TimberSills and SashesNon-toxic, 50-year above-ground guarantee, very little motion.
Toughened Slim GlassGlazing12mm-14mm density; fits period frames while supplying insulation.
Lead WeightsInternal BoxPrecision balancing for heavy double-glazed units.
Nylon Core CordsHanging SystemHigh tensile strength; withstands rot and extending better than cotton.
Epoxy ResinsWood RepairBonds with wood fibers to create a long-term, weatherproof seal.

Modern Innovations in Performance

Among the most substantial reasons to speak with sash window specialists is their capability to upgrade efficiency without sacrificing aesthetic appeals. Many homeowners believe they should select between being warm and keeping their initial windows. Nevertheless, specialists supply numerous options:

Draught Proofing Systems

Modern draught-proofing is essentially undetectable once set up. By machining grooves into the timber beads and setting up pile providers, professionals can minimize heat loss by up to 30%. This likewise functions as an acoustic barrier, considerably minimizing external street noise.

Retrofit Double Glazing

Experts now use "slim-lite" double-glazed units. These systems have a very narrow cavity filled with insulating gases like Krypton or Xenon. Since they are so thin, they can be suited the initial sash frames, keeping the fragile profile of the glazing bars that specify the window's character.

How to Choose a Sash Window Expert

Selecting the best expert is important for the longevity of the installation. Homeowner ought to search for the following criteria:

  • Portfolio of Heritage Work: A credible specialist ought to have the ability to show experience dealing with listed buildings or within sanctuary.
  • Accreditations: Look for memberships in trade bodies such as FENSA, The Guild of Master Craftsmen, or the Glass and Glazing Federation (GGF).
  • Comprehensive Guarantees: Reliable specialists generally offer a 10-year warranty on craftsmanship and particular guarantees for the wood and glass systems.
  • Specialized Knowledge: They should be able to go over the specific species of lumber they utilize and provide comprehensive descriptions of their draught-proofing methods.

Regularly Asked Questions (FAQ)

Can sash windows be double glazed?Yes. Sash window professionals can either retrofit slim-profile double glazing into existing sashes or produce new sashes to match the originals that are developed to hold thicker glass units.

Is it much better to repair or change sash windows?In the bulk of cases, remediation is more suitable. Top quality antique lumber is often superior to modern-day softwoods. Restoration preserves the property's value and is more eco-friendly than complete replacement.

Do I require preparing permission to repair my sash windows?Generally, repair work and draught-proofing do not require preparation consent. Nevertheless, if the building is "Listed," or if you are moving from single to double glazing in a stringent sanctuary, you may need to get Listed Building Consent. A professional can frequently assist with this documents.

How long do restored sash windows last?With proper upkeep and the usage of modern materials like Accoya or premium resins, a professionally restored sash window can last several decades. Routine painting every 5-8 years is generally the only maintenance required.

Why are my sash windows rattling?Rattling is normally triggered by a gap between the sash and the beads. This occurs as wood diminishes over time or when initial beads are worn. A professional draught-proofing service will fill these gaps and stop the motion while allowing the window to slide smoothly.
